"Life According to Agfa" is the story of Leora and Dalia, the two young Tel-Avivian
women partners who own and run a successful typical Tel-Avivian pub. Daila,
a divorcee with one daughter, has a lover Eli, a married man who suffers from
cancer but refuses treatment in order to prevent any affront to his self-pride
and dignity.
Leora, unmarried, also has a lover, Benny, a police commissioner and also a
bachelor. He shares an apartment with her but sleeps indiscriminately with any
girl who may cross his path any place and any time.
Throughout the film we encounter moments and situations accentuated by black
and white depictions that are taken by Leora, a photographer by profession,
and that cut through the body of the film every once in a while for a few seconds
systematically, freezing elements worthy of emphasis (and hence the film's title).
Assi Dayan began his career as an actor, playing principal roles in such films
as John Huston's A Walk With Love And Death (1969) and Jules Dassin's Promise
At Dawn (1970). He went on to establish himself as a columnist, novelist
and screenwriter.
Israel/1998/100mins
Direction & Screenplay: Assi Dayan
Cast: Gila Almagor, Irit Frank, Shuli Rand, Avital Dicker, Barak Negbi
